Structure Forlabels Founded 1986 2 owners (brothers) 40 employees Iris Printing SA Founded 1991 2 shareholders: Lambrakis Press SA Pegasus Publishing SA 25 % of the market
Machinery and equipments Forlabels UV-machine (old) 2 x flexoprintingmachine HP Indigo Digicon for postpress (trimming, coating, foiling) Web to webtrimming Iris Printing SA 2 x Roland 700 (sheet-fed / web) 3 x KBA SP 102-E Billhofergula-speedpartiomatUV-coatingequipment Folding BobstFolding (for boxes) 2 x Shredder (withcontainer)
Building and rooms Iris Printing SA Building big and old Room for platemaking and colormanagement Paper warehouse burned down a year ago Forlabels 2 halls (printing room/ warehouse) Different room for HP Indigo (airconditioned) Own rooms for sales, prepress and platemaking
Production • Iris Printing SA • Employees in: • Prepress • Platemaking • Color management • Printing • Postpress • Main product: • Magazines • Forlabels • Employees: • 4 persons in salesdepartment • 4 persons in prepress • Platemaking • Printing • Postpress • Main product: • Labels

Material management, input and output of materials and finalproducts Iris Printing SA Company was moving, so we didn’t get right picture of their material management. Buildings was almost empty, so we don’t know where the materials and final products were stored. • Forlabels • Everything was well organized • Every job was marked with an EAN-code and stored systematically • Used printing plates was stored systematically in own packagings • Outgoing jobs
General conditions, environmetalaspects Iris Printing SA Working conditions not very good, high temperature and smell of chemicals Old equipment (not environmental friendly) Effective paper recycling • Forlabels • Very clean places • Good working conditions • Much empty space • Could be more selfs in warehouse
Comparisation to Finnish companies In Finland the printing plants are usually very clean and organized Working conditions are good Papers are usually stored at print plants for paper manufacturers Many printhouses has environment labels Finnish companies also have very big and impressive lobbies
